What to Anticipate Throughout Your First Orthodontic Session
When you're considering orthodontic treatment to achieve a straighter smile, your first step is a session with an orthodontist. This initial appointment is essential for understanding your dental wants, exploring treatment options, and determining whether or not braces, clear aligners, or one other solution is true for you. Knowing what to expect throughout your first orthodontic session might help ease any nervousness and set you up for a smooth journey toward a healthier, more confident smile.
1. Warm Welcome and Patient Intake
If you arrive for your consultation, you will be greeted by the front desk workers who will guide you through the patient intake process. You'll typically be asked to fill out paperwork detailing your medical and dental history. If you're visiting a family orthodontist, your child or teen may additionally need to provide similar information.
Bringing a list of questions or considerations is a superb way to make probably the most of your visit. When you're feeling nervous or uncertain about the process, don’t fear—this first appointment is primarily about gathering information and getting comfortable with your treatment options.
2. Initial Examination and Oral Assessment
Subsequent, you’ll meet the orthodontist who will perform a thorough examination of your mouth, teeth, and jaw. This oral assessment allows them to determine any alignment issues, bite problems, or signs of overcrowding.
In the course of the examination, the orthodontist can also ask about any discomfort, habits like tooth grinding, or previous dental treatments. This is a good time to share any particular goals you will have, reminiscent of improving your bite or enhancing your smile aesthetics.
3. Diagnostic Imaging and Records
To get a complete picture of your dental structure, the orthodontist will typically request diagnostic records, which could embrace:
Digital X-rays
Photographs of your face and tooth
Dental impressions or digital scans
These images assist consider jaw alignment, root positioning, and the overall health of your tooth and gums. Immediately’s technology permits for fast, accurate 3D scans that replace messy traditional molds in many clinics.
4. Discussion of Treatment Options
Primarily based on your examination and diagnostic records, the orthodontist will clarify your particular dental considerations and recommend treatment options. These would possibly include:
Traditional metal braces
Ceramic braces
Clear aligners like Invisalign
Retainers or other dental appliances
The orthodontist will clarify the pros and cons of each option, treatment duration, and how they'll achieve your desired results. When you’re a candidate for clear aligners, it's possible you'll even see a digital preview of your potential smile transformation.
5. Timeline and Cost Estimate
Once a treatment plan is discussed, the workers will walk you through the next steps, including the estimated timeline and cost. They will also clarify payment options, insurance coverage, and available financing plans.
Most orthodontic offices provide versatile payment arrangements and work with varied insurance providers to help make treatment affordable. Make sure you ask about reductions for upfront payments or family plans.
6. Q&A and Next Steps
Earlier than leaving, you’ll have the opportunity to ask any remaining questions. Common considerations may embody how often you’ll need to visit the office, how to care for braces or aligners, and what to expect throughout treatment.
In the event you feel ready, chances are you'll be able to schedule your next appointment right away. If not, take your time to assessment the information at home earlier than making a decision.
Your first orthodontic consultation is a friendly, informative session designed that can assist you understand your dental alignment and explore your treatment options. It’s not a commitment—it’s an opportunity to be taught more about your smile and how orthodontic care can improve it. Whether or not you are considering braces on your child or clear aligners for yourself, this initial visit is the first step toward a healthier, more confident smile.
